在当今数字化的时代,在线聊天室已经成为人们交流的重要平台。无论是社交、学习还是工作,聊天室都为用户提供了便捷的实时沟通方式。然而,随着用户数量的增加,恶意用户网络攻击的风险也随之而来。如何保护聊天室的安全,防止不良行为的侵蚀,成为了运营者亟需解决的问题。本文将深入探讨在线聊天室如何有效防范恶意用户和网络攻击,为用户提供一个安全、健康的交流环境。

1. 实名认证与用户注册机制

为了防止恶意用户的涌入,实名认证和严格的用户注册机制是第一步。通过要求用户提供真实信息并验证其身份,可以有效降低匿名用户进行恶意行为的可能性。例如,可以结合手机号码或邮箱进行双重验证,确保每个账号的真实性。此外,限制同一设备或IP地址注册多个账号,也能有效防止恶意用户的批量注册行为。

2. 内容过滤与敏感词检测

聊天室中的不良内容是影响用户体验的重要因素。通过引入内容过滤敏感词检测技术,可以自动识别并屏蔽不适当的信息。例如,利用自然语言处理(NLP)技术,系统可以实时检测用户发送的文本,过滤掉包含暴力、色情、政治敏感等内容的词汇。同时,还可以设置自定义关键词库,根据实际需求灵活调整过滤规则。

3. 用户行为分析与异常监控

恶意用户的行为往往具有一定的规律性,通过用户行为分析可以及时发现异常。例如,系统可以监控用户的发言频率、内容倾向以及与其他用户的互动情况。如果某用户在短时间内频繁发送相同内容或进行大量负面评论,系统可以自动将其标记为可疑用户,并采取限制发言或封号等措施。此外,结合机器学习算法,还可以进一步优化异常检测的准确性和效率。

4. 权限管理与分级控制

为了确保聊天室的秩序,权限管理分级控制是必不可少的。通过将用户划分为不同的等级(如普通用户、管理员、超级管理员),可以赋予不同用户相应的操作权限。例如,普通用户只能发送消息,而管理员则可以删除不当内容或封禁恶意用户。这种分级控制机制不仅能有效遏制恶意行为,还能减轻运营者的管理负担。

5. 加密技术与数据保护

网络攻击往往以窃取用户数据或破坏系统为目的,因此加密技术是保护聊天室安全的重要手段。通过使用SSL/TLS协议对数据传输进行加密,可以有效防止数据在传输过程中被截取或篡改。此外,对用户的敏感信息(如密码、聊天记录)进行加密存储,也能降低数据泄露的风险。同时,定期更新软件和修复漏洞,也是防止网络攻击的重要措施。

6. 反垃圾与反机器人机制

垃圾信息机器人账号是聊天室中常见的问题。为了防止这些干扰,可以引入反垃圾反机器人机制。例如,通过验证码、答题或行为验证等方式,区分真实用户与机器人。此外,还可以利用IP地址、设备指纹等技术,识别并封禁恶意来源。对于频繁发送广告或垃圾信息的用户,系统可以自动限制其发言权限或直接封号。

7. 举报与反馈机制

用户的参与是维护聊天室安全的重要力量。通过建立举报与反馈机制,可以鼓励用户主动报告不良行为。例如,在每条消息旁添加举报按钮,用户只需点击即可将可疑内容提交给管理员处理。同时,运营者应及时响应用户的反馈,并对举报内容进行核实和处理。这不仅能够提高用户的安全感,还能有效遏制恶意行为的蔓延。

8. 教育与引导

除了技术手段,用户教育行为引导也是防止恶意行为的重要方式。通过发布社区规范、安全提示等内容,可以帮助用户了解哪些行为是不被允许的。此外,定期举办安全知识讲座或在线培训,也能提高用户的网络安全意识,减少因无知而导致的违规行为。

9. 数据备份与恢复

在网络攻击中,数据丢失是可能面临的风险之一。因此,定期进行数据备份和建立恢复机制是保障聊天室安全的重要措施。通过将用户数据、聊天记录等信息备份到安全的存储介质中,可以在系统遭受攻击或出现故障时快速恢复数据,最大限度地减少损失。

10. 持续优化与更新

网络安全是一个动态的过程,持续优化更新是保持聊天室安全的必要条件。运营者应定期分析用户反馈和安全日志,发现潜在的问题并及时改进。同时,关注最新的网络安全技术和趋势,将其应用到聊天室的防护系统中,才能有效应对不断变化的威胁。

通过以上措施,在线聊天室可以显著降低恶意用户和网络攻击的风险,为用户创造一个安全、舒适的交流环境。无论是运营者还是用户,都应共同努力,维护聊天室的健康发展。